If you're looking for a spot that captures the laid-back vibe of Fishtown while hosting some seriously cool events, Johnny Brenda's is where it's at. Opened back in 2003, this place has become a staple for local music lovers and arts fans alike. Its outdoor patio turns into a lively scene during summer concerts, with folks chilling out and soaking up live tunes under the stars. Inside, the vibe is just as inviting, with cozy tavern seating that offers a great view of both the stage and the bartenders crafting creative cocktails. Weekly open mic nights give aspiring musicians a shot to shine, which honestly keeps the scene fresh and unpredictable.
